Join Anna Fialkoff, horticulturist at Connecticut College Arboretum, for a workshop on ecological pruning during the dormant season. With leaves down and the bones of the garden revealed, winter is a great time to evaluate and prune woody plants for their structure, form, health, and vigor. Plus, hibernating creatures and frozen ground make ideal timing for tromping around garden beds with minimal disturbance.
During this two-hour workshop at Fort Williams Park, Anna will demonstrate best pruning techniques and provide an overview of basic pruning principles, while emphasizing how to enhance wildlife habitat. Participants will get hands-on experience with selecting tools, making proper cuts, and assessing trees and shrubs for pruning goals.
